Transaction e6a988c076f89c8b8aafc5317d59db40b29c72ae59bddaed542acdddb42e44f2
1 Input
1 Output
-
e6a988c076f89c8b8aafc5317d59db40b29c72ae59bddaed542acdddb42e44f2:0
- value
- 21348694
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94fb3982a033ccc1aa2ef7ed5fc636bda8184a59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EajxnZcyMKqqxvaZz9E2jRaBPivwkywXo